Loads of fun, just a bit short!
I didn't know what to expect when I picked this game up...but I was not disappointed.
If you're trying to simply finish the game without collecting all the items and treasure, it is over very quickly. However, there are some very challenging parts to the game - some of the bosses are very difficult to beat, and you have to think quite strategically about how to get to certain treasure chests. I've always been a fan of platform games which involve collecting items, so this one was straight down my street.
The music is really fun to listen to too!
Kirby Mouse attack-is it living up to standards? Read on...
I bought KMA with high hopes. I was slightly disapointed with graphics,shortness and sometimes being plane hard, but the game has some good parts. So many abilities and different kinds of levels make the game interesting, providing a thrill. The treasure chest segments make you overly excited pressing buttons rapidly to get away from the squeak squad. Some bosses are overly hard, especially the one on world 3. On completing the game,you are given the chance to collect all items and puzzle pieces as you wish. Overall,the game is short and sweet,provides a thrill to new players but however lacks a bit of Kirby magic. Buy it if you want, but be warned it is quite short.
SO ADDICTIVE-it's not even funny!
I bought Kirby Squeak Squad/mouse attack a few weeks ago and I haven't been able to put it down! After a day of playing this you will fall in love with the adorable bumbling ball that is Kirby! Kirby jumps around in exciting, cute environments transforming himself into anything from ninja, UFO, fireball to swordsman depending on who he swallows. Each transformation has its own unique quality, which you begin to apprecaite as you try to obtain the chests in the game. The stylus is mainly used to trigger kirby's abilities and mix them up, but gameplay is generally restricted to the buttons.
All in all loads of fun and even though you may think it's easy at first it does get progressively more difficult. Definately a game you can pick up anytime of the day. :)
